mcp-yapi-server
Rank #47122glama/TStoneLee/mcp-yapi-server
Enables direct integration with YApi API documentation platform in MCP-compatible editors like Cursor, allowing users to query API details, list interfaces, and search endpoints by simply pasting YApi URLs.
mcp-yapi-server is a Model Context Protocol (MCP) server published by TStoneLee. It ranks #47122 of 58,900 servers tracked on MCP Toplist. mcp-yapi-server is listed on Glama, and ships as a single rolling release with no explicit version metadata. It was first listed on Dec 5, 2025.
